The amount of recovery always depends on the facts of the case. Punitive damages are only awarded in West Virginia in cases where the health care provider has acted fraudulently, maliciously, or intentionally. On the other hand, compensatory damages, comprised of both economic (actual and quantifiable) and noneconomic (pain and suffering, loss of consortium) damages, are more commonly awarded. 34 See Medical Malpractice: A Preventive Approach, by William Robinson, M.D., U. of Washington Press, 1984. Unfortunately, there are also tragic instances when breast cancer is detectible on a screening mammogram, but the radiologist misreads the mammogam and fails to report the cancer to the patient and her physician. Our firm recently represented a 44-year-old woman who was diagnosed with advanced stage breast cancer despite the fact that she had received regular yearly mammograms prior to her diagnosis, all of which were reported to be normal. Our firm obtained all of our client's prior mammogram films and sent them to two prominent radiology experts who are affilitated with top medical schools. Each expert independently concluded that our client's breast cancer was plainly visible on the mammogram that she had received approximately one year prior to her diagnosis. Our firm subsequently retained two prominent oncology experts who advised us that our client's cancer was still at an early stage and could have been successfully treated when the radiologist failed to detect and report it one year prior to her diagnosis. Costs are paid back to the law firm when your case resolves, and must be paid from the client's share of the proceeds-in addition to the fee. This means that, if the client receives a settlement of 1 million dollars, and the contingent fee agreement is for a 40% fee, the client pays the lawyers $400.000 for their fee, and then, from the client's $600,000 share of the proceeds, reimburses the lawyers for the costs accrued to prepare the case. If costs were $100,000, the the net recovery to the client is $500,000.The fact that costs are reimbursed from the client's share of the proceeds is not arbitrary. To the contrary, it is actually required by law in most (if not all) states. Some lawyers charge interest on costs, because the money is essentially 'borrowed' from them for the duration of the litigation. Burg Simpson does not charge interest on the costs we advance for our clients. Fees and costs are also different from subrogation liens , which must also come from the client's share of the proceeds. It is not difficult to understand how, with the various sums that must be paid out from a potential settlement or award, cases might sometimes cost more to pursue than they can be worth. Professional negligence claims may not arise from every mistake made by a professional (e.g. solicitor, accountant, architect). The test to be applied is whether the mistake is one which no reasonably competent professional should have made and whether it has caused the client any financial disadvantage. Although medical devices are used regularly to diagnose, treat, or prevent diseases, sometimes their failure or misuse results in serious injury or death to a patient. There are three major types of defects in medical devices that might cause injury and open up a manufacturer to liability. These are manufacturing defects, design defects and inadequate warnings. In the case of one of these problems, the manufacturer of the device may be sued if the defect causes injury or death. Khallouf had already been found guilty in eight previous instances of retail theft when he was arrested once more in June of 2015 for attempting to steal products from a retail store. It was not until July 10, 2015 that the state Board of Dentistry indefinitely suspended his dental license. The Plaintiff also suffered from dislocation of the pubic symphasis. As solicitors for the Plaintiff we alleged that had an episiotomy been performed the injuries would not have occurred and that it was negligent not to perform this procedure. Liability was denied with a full defence filed. The week before trial settlement negotiations commenced and the case ultimately settled, without an admission of liability, for $150,000 plus costs. Wrongful death statutes are designed to compensate the patient's family for their future monetary loss. The calculation is more thorough than a simple projection of future salary - it also considers factors like the patient's spending, saving, and working habits. Compensation for the family's loss of companionship or emotional harm is typically not allowed under the wrongful death statues, although recently some states have allowed that kind of recovery. Depending on the state, not all family members can recover. For example, a state may allow the patient's spouse and children to recover damages, but not the patient's parents (at least in the case of an adult patient). Although medical malpractice is really a form of negligence, it must be proven through the use of expert witnesses. Doctors are usually needed to evaluate cases and to testify against other doctors. Similarly, nurses are frequently required to testify against other nurses. Defense lawyers hire their own experts in an effort to defeat the plaintiff's case. In medical malpractice trials, the jury is usually left to decide which side's experts offered a more credible explanation of a health care provider's conduct and whether such conduct fell below the standard of care required under the circumstances. It is a frightening aspect of modern medicine that lawyers for both sides can generally find well-credentialed doctors to support their positions. In order to pursue any medical negligence case it is necessary to show a deviation from the standard of care-basically meaning the level at which the average, prudent provider in a given community would practice. It is how similarly qualified practitioners would have managed the patient's care under the same or similar circumstances. In order to find out if you were the victim of negligence, you need to retain a lawyer willing to investigate the claim. The lawyer will gather your medical records and have them reviewed by a medical expert who will be asked to offer an opinion as to whether 1. the care and treatment you received fell below the applicable standard of care and 2. caused an injury. There is no claim to pursue unless and until such an opinion is secured. Even if you were the victim of negligence, these cases are risky and expensive to pursue and if you have not suffered a severe or permanent injury, the cost may outweigh the benefits of pursuit. Read More NHS Foundation Trusts will have their own systems for the internally handling of complaints, which may differ from the local resolution process described here. If you have a complaint about an NHS Foundation Trust, you should contact if for advice on how to make your complaint. The independent review stage carried out by the healthcare commission does apply to NHS Foundation Trusts, which are also covered by the Health Service Ombudsman. A more fundamental problem is that damages caps don't do much to improve the quality of care that is being delivered. There is plenty of evidence that the quality of American health care isn't what it should be - but providers receive the benefits of a damages cap whether they have made great effort or no effort to improve the quality of services they are providing.

Typically if you buy a policy right out of dental school you'll have a set premium that will not be altered over time. You will pay the exact same amount and your policy will be non-cancelable. If you're ten years later or twenty years later you will be able to rely on that policy even if a bunch of horrible happen to you medically. The policy will still be in place. Tolling 3.1.4.1 On-Going Litigation Rule: On-going litigation will only toll the statute of limitations if the attorney accused of the malpractice continues to represent the client in that matter (i.e., Continuous Representation Doctrine; see, paragraph 3.1.3 above); otherwise, the statute begins to run from the date of the malpractice (see, paragraph 3.1.1 above). Authority: An action to recover damages arising from legal malpractice must be commenced within three years after accrual citations omitted. The action accrues when the malpractice is committed citations omitted. Causes of action alleging legal malpractice which would otherwise be barred by the statute of limitations are timely if the doctrine of continuous representation applies citations omitted. Macaluso v. Del Col, 95 A.D.3d 959, 960,944 N.Y.S.2d 589, 590 (2d Dep't 2012). 3.1.4.2 Fraudulent Concealment Rule: Under the doctrine of equitable estoppel, a defendant-attorney can be barred from asserting a statute of limitations defense (very rare). Authority: Equitable estoppel is an 'extraordinary remedy' citation omitted which will 'bar the assertion of the affirmative defense of the Statute of Limitations where it is the defendant's affirmative wrongdoing...which produced the long delay between the accrual of the cause of action and the institution of the legal proceeding' citation omitted. A plaintiff seeking to invoke this doctrine must demonstrate subsequent, specific actions by defendant which kept plaintiff from timely bringing suit citations omitted. Plaintiffs must show the element of justifiable reliance on defendant's deception, fraud, or misrepresentations that effectively prevented the former from bringing suit in a timely fashion citations omitted. Despite astonishing progress in modern medicine - diagnostics, surgeries, arthroscopy, imaging technology, trauma treatment, and much more - human error is still a serious danger in the profession. Not just doctors, but technicians, nurses, radiation specialists are prone to making mistakes, due to poor judgment calls, excessive confidence, improper training, or fatigue. Whether caused by incompetence or indifference, if negligence or other failures result in damage to a patient - that is, permanent injury or disability - then a viable malpractice case can be pursued by the injured party or a loved one such as a spouse, child, sibling, or other family member.
